I understand that only a few kernel team members will be attending DebConf 10. (I will not.) Therefore I think it would be useful to arrange a real-life team meeting on some other occasion.
It was very useful to meet upstream and other distribution developers at LPC last year, it was also quite expensive for the project. Given that most regular members live in Europe, I suggest that we limit travel expenses by meeting at a European conference like Linux-Kongress <http://www.linux-kongress.org/2010/> or FrOSCon <http://www.froscon.org/>. Alternately we could try to arrange a sponsored work session in Extremadura if people think that would be productive.
